Next week is I Love to Read Week. As part of the celebration of reading, we are doing some fun activities each day. Students are encouraged to complete their reading BINGO sheets, come to the library and see what books teachers love, guess the conversation hearts, and more. Although we don't have school on Monday, we'd like to encourage students share a favorite book or passage with family and friends.

Big Horn County School District #4 Board of Trustees is searching for a district resident/registered voter who resides within Area K/L (Manderson - Hyattville) to appoint as a trustee for an unfilled term. Anyone interested in serving should submit as soon as possible and no later than February 1, 2025, a letter of interest explaining a little about yourself and your interest in serving on the Board. Please address the letter of interest to: Jory Thompson, Superintendent Big Horn County School District #4 PO Box 151 Basin, WY 82410 Should the selected individual wish to remain on the Board, he/she will be required to file and run in the November 2026 election.
